Archaeology Notes

NR44NW 8006 4376 4797

N55 39.45 W6 4.45

NLO: Loch a' Chnuic [name centred NR 439 478]

Sound of Jura [name centred NR 64 78].

Formerly entered as NR44NW 9239.

Horizontal Datum = OGB

General water depth = 2

Circumstances of Loss Details

-----------------------------

A small wooden sailing yacht was wrecked near Rudha Sconash, Islay.

Letter from P L Sellars, 11 February 1975.

Surveying Details

-----------------------------

25 January 1975. A small yacht was wrecked near Rudha Sconash, Islay in 55 39 27N, 006 04 27W. There is little left. It lies at a depth of 2.4 metres.

Letter from P L Sellars, 11 Febraury 1975.

Hydrographic Office, 1995.

(Classified as yacht). Unknown. [No date of loss or further information cited].

(Location cited as N55 39.45 W6 4.45).

I G Whittaker 1998.

Rubha Sconash is not noted on the 1999 edition of the OS 1:50,000 map. The location indicated falls within Loch a' Chnuic [name centred NR 439 478], a small embayment projecting into the SE coast of Islay to the NE of Kildalton House (NR44NW 41.00, at NR 43680 47526).

This wreck is not indicated on UKHO chart no. 2168 (1977, amended 1989).

Information from RCAHMS (RJCM), 6 May 2002.
